    “Book Descriptions: A brand-new hockey romance series from S.R. Grey!

    Bad-boy hockey player Hayden Harrington always lands on his feet. Or skates, in this case.

    After a scandalous fling with the coach’s daughter comes to light, this good-looking hotshot forward is swiftly traded to the Atlanta Thunder—an up-and-coming new hockey team.

    It’s not all bad, though.

    This could be his big chance to play center on the top line.

    So yeah, maybe it’s fortuitous that the pesky team marketing intern, Addison Knight, let his secret out.

    Still, though she’s hot as sin, he’s happy he’ll never have to see her again.

    Or will he?

    What Hayden doesn’t know is Addison just landed a job with the Thunder too. And what it involves is spending an exorbitant amount of time with him working on rehabilitating his image.

    Ha, like that’ll go well.

    Hayden is an enemies-to-friends love story and the first book in the new Breakaway Hockey romance series.

    *can be read as a standalone*”
